
However, these concerts were c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ic. She was also announced as the opening act for Niall Horan's Nice to Meet Ya Tour on tour dates in Europe. In 2020, Peters contributed the song "Smile" to the soundtrack album Birds of Prey: The Album, for the film Birds of Prey. Under Atlantic, she released various singles, notably "Worst Of You", as well as two EPs Dressed Too Nice for a Jacket and It's Your Bed Babe, It's Your Funeral.

Following this attention, Peters signed with Atlantic Records UK. The songs gained attention in indie-pop circles and "Place We Were Made" was named BBC Introducing's song of the week early 2018. Four months later, she released her second single, "Birthday". In August of 2017, Peters independently released her debut single, "Place We Were Made". Career Peters performing at the El Rey Theatre in 2022.Īt age 15 in 2016, Peters performed her first recorded show, performing several original songs on The Ayala Show. At age 15, she began busking on the streets of Brighton and uploading original songs to YouTube. She wrote her first song at age nine and began writing songs regularly at the age of 12, after borrowing her friend's guitar for a school project. Peters began singing around age eight, performing in choirs. She has a twin sister, Ellen, who has been featured on her YouTube channel and was the inspiration behind Peters' 2021 single "Brooklyn". Maisie Hannah Peters was born on in Steyning, a small town in West Sussex, England to a teacher and communications worker.

Peters became the youngest solo British female artist to claim a number one on the UK Charts in almost a decade with The Good Witch. Peters released her second album, The Good Witch, in June 2023. Shortly afterwards, she released her debut studio album, You Signed Up for This.

In 2021, she left Atlantic and signed with Ed Sheeran's Gingerbread Man Records label.
